Compare all specifications:
1961 Abarth 1000 Bialbero | 1954 Humber Super Snipe | |
Make | Abarth | Humber |
Model | 1000 Bialbero | Super Snipe |
Year Released | 1961 | 1954 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 988 cc | 4136 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 93 HP | 114 HP |
Engine RPM | 7000 RPM | 3400 RPM |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 550 kg | 1890 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3490 mm | 5050 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1420 mm | 1870 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1170 mm | 1680 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2010 mm | 2950 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 60 L | 68 L |
